## Clock skew between build agents

If Fernhollow builds fail with "artifact timestamp in future," an agent's clock has drifted. Check NTP sync on all agents in the pool, resync, and requeue the job. Skew over 90 seconds auto-quarantines the agent. Confirm recovery by inspecting the token printed below.

session token of tajef-bageg = htk21_5d90d574934f3ccae6437

**Ticket: Sheetforge export workers exhausting memory in the Calder cluster**

Priority: High

The spreadsheet export service is loading entire workbooks into memory because `SF_STREAM_MODE` is unset in the Calder environment, falling back to the legacy buffered path. Large exports (over 200k rows) then OOM the worker pods. Please set `SF_STREAM_MODE=chunked` and `SF_CHUNK_ROWS=5000` in the env file.

While editing, also restore the missing storage credential on the next line:

env line for fafof-fahag: LEDGER_TOKEN5=f8790

## Kiosk Watchdog — Overview for Maintainers

The Foyerlight kiosk app runs under a watchdog that restarts the renderer after three consecutive heartbeat misses, each spaced five seconds apart. Restart events are reported to the internal fleet telemetry service so we can distinguish crashes from deliberate reboots. That reporting call is authenticated per device class, not per unit. The telemetry key the watchdog must be provisioned with appears below.

service key, fawip-bajef: kto11_Qt5wZK9vdNC